  • Page 5 Before you start MHTP24EB by MacAllister Fuel and engine oil WARNING! This product is not supplied with fuel-oil mixture in the engine! Before operating this product it is essential to fill it with fuel This product is equipped with a 2-stroke engine, the fuel and oil tank are combined and it is essential to fill fuel-oil mixture before operating this product. Observe the technical specifictions for suitable fuel and engine oil. WARNING! Fuel and oil are highly inflammable! Fumes...
  • Page 6 Before you start MHTP24EB by MacAllister Fuel and engine oil > Avoid spilling and overfilling the tank. > Wipe up spilled fuel with a soft cloth and refit the fuel tank cap (10). > Always dispose of fuel, used oil and soiled objects according to local regulations (see section “Recycling and disposal”). 5 mm 40:1 35:1 Fig. 1 Fig. 2 WARNING! Fuel and oil deteriorate over time. It may be difficult to start the engine if you use fuel which has been kept for more than 30 days. Towards the end of the season,...

  • Page 13 Product functions MHTP24EB by MacAllister Handle controls There are three controls at the handle (16) with the following functions. > The ignition switch (14) enables the manual starting or the stopping of the engine. > The throttle interlock (13) prevents unintentional activation of the throttle trigger until manually released.
  • Page 14 Product functions MHTP24EB by MacAllister Starting / Stopping > Hold the product stable and pull recoil starter handle (15) slowly until you feel a definite resistance and then give it a brisk, strong pull. Repeat until the engine starts (Fig. 10).
  • Page 15 Product functions MHTP24EB by MacAllister Cutting > Press the throttle interlock (13), hold it in position and then press the throttle trigger (12) to engage the cutting device. > Release the throttle trigger (12) to stop the cutting device (4). Stopping > Release the throttle trigger (12) and let the product run at its idle speed for 10 – 15 seconds.

    Care and maintenance MHTP24EB by MacAllister Cutting blade WARNING! Wear safety gloves when working on the cutting device and close to it! Use appropriate tools to remove debris e.g. a brush or wooden stick! Never use your bare hands! > Keep the cutting blade (4) clean and free of debris. Remove trimmings.
  • Page 21 Care and maintenance MHTP24EB by MacAllister Air filter > Inspect the air filter regularly. Replace it with a new one if necessary. > Open the air filter case by losing the fixing screw (7). Then remove the screw (7), cover (6) and take the filter out (Fig. 17). > Tap the filter on a stable surface to remove dust.
  • Page 22 Care and maintenance MHTP24EB by MacAllister Spark plug > Code of the spark plug : NHSP LD L8RTF. > Inspect the spark plug at least every 25 hours or prior to longterm storage over 30 days if the use has not been this high. Clean or replace with a new spark plug if necessary.
  • Page 23 Care and maintenance MHTP24EB by MacAllister Carburettor The carburettor is pre-set by the manufacturer. Should it be necessary to make any changes please contact an authorised service centre or a similarly qualifiedperson. Do not attempt to make any adjustments by yourself.   • Page 25 Care and maintenance MHTP24EB by MacAllister Storage > Clean the product as described above. > Store the product and its accessories in a dark, dry, frost-free, well-ventilated place. > Always store the product in a place that is inaccessible to children. The ideal storage temperature is between 10 and 30°C.

  • Page 34 Technical and legal information MHTP24EB by MacAllister Safety warnings Maintenance and storage > When the product is stopped for servicing, inspection or storage, shut off the power source, disconnect the spark plug wire from the spark plug and make sure all moving parts have come to a stop. Allow the product to cool before making any inspections, adjustments, etc. > Store the product where the fuel vapour will not reach an open flame or spark.
